The Southern Delta Aquariids meteor shower will peak on July 29 and 30, offering a chance to see up to 25 meteors per hour in Singapore's skies.

The Southern Delta Aquariids meteor shower is an annual celestial event that captivates skywatchers around the world, and this year, it is set to illuminate the skies over Singapore on July 29 and 30. This meteor shower is particularly notable for its potential to produce up to 25 meteors per hour under ideal viewing conditions, making it an exciting opportunity for both amateur and seasoned astronomers alike.

The phenomenon of meteor showers occurs when Earth passes through trails of dust and debris left behind by comets. In the case of the Southern Delta Aquariids, this annual event is linked to Comet 96P/Machholz, which sheds tiny particles as it travels through the inner solar system. When these particles enter Earth’s atmosphere at speeds reaching up to 150,000 miles per hour (approximately 241,000 kilometers per hour), they ignite due to friction with the atmosphere, creating bright streaks of light commonly referred to as shooting stars.

The Science Centre Observatory in Singapore has provided guidance on the best times to witness this celestial display. Stargazers are encouraged to look to the skies between 2 AM and 5:30 AM on both days of the peak. During this period, the sky is typically darker, providing optimal conditions for viewing the meteors. However, the observatory has also noted that the peak of the meteor shower coincides with a full moon on July 29. The brightness of the full moon may hinder visibility for some of the fainter meteors, potentially reducing the overall experience for viewers. This interplay between lunar brightness and meteor visibility is a crucial factor that observers must consider when planning their viewing experience.

For those interested in maximizing their viewing experience, the observatory recommends several locations around Singapore that are known for their minimal light pollution. Ideal viewing spots include East Coast Park, Changi Beach Park, West Coast Park, Marina Barrage, and the Southern Ridges. These locations are advantageous due to their open spaces and the reduced presence of artificial lighting, which can obstruct the view of the night sky. Light pollution is a significant concern for urban areas like Singapore, where bright city lights can drown out the visibility of celestial events. As such, stargazers are advised to seek out darker areas away from the glow of city lights.

In addition to finding the right location, viewers should take care to prepare their eyes for night viewing by avoiding bright screens prior to watching the meteor shower. It is recommended to allow the eyes 20 to 30 minutes to adjust to the darkness, which can enhance the ability to spot the meteors as they streak across the sky. This adjustment period is crucial, as the human eye takes time to adapt to low-light conditions, and doing so can significantly improve the viewing experience.

Understanding the science behind meteor showers can enhance the appreciation of these events. Meteor showers are not only beautiful to observe but also provide insights into the solar system's history and the materials that make up comets. The particles that create meteors are remnants from the early solar system, offering a glimpse into the conditions that existed when our solar system was forming. By studying these particles, scientists can learn more about the composition of comets, the processes that lead to the formation of meteors, and the dynamics of our solar system.
